Output 7b288aa21a7878a79acf5309f59aa40a9069c952c53b3d832020f870d3965647:36

value
29226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3a97c33be717fe5ecd84131e41863ecb1f1db5a OP_EQUAL
address
3LzBY4BUENSdHvBaWvFGqmaMRAkXUMesbX
transaction
7b288aa21a7878a79acf5309f59aa40a9069c952c53b3d832020f870d3965647
spent
true